当前位置:首页 > 生活小常识 > 正文
已解决

浮点数在C语言中的输出方式

来自网友在路上 196896提问 提问时间:2023-08-17 19:01:32阅读次数: 96

最佳答案 问答题库968位专家为你答疑解惑

浮点数在C语言中的输出方式

浮点数是C语言中的一种数据类型,用于表示带有小数部分的数值。在C语言中,我们可以使用不同的方式来输出浮点数,以满足不同的需求。

使用 %f 格式化输出

在C语言中,最常用的输出浮点数的方式是使用 `%f` 格式化输出。这种方式可以输出浮点数的全部小数位数,并默认保留6位小数。

改变小数位数

如果需要改变浮点数输出的小数位数,可以在 `%f` 后面加上一个点号和想要保留的小数位数,例如 `%f.2` 表示保留两位小数。

科学计数法输出

除了常规的十进制形式,C语言还支持以科学计数法的形式输出浮点数。使用 `%e` 或 `%E` 可以将浮点数转化为科学计数法表示。

控制宽度和对齐

为了在输出时控制浮点数的宽度和对齐方式,可以使用 `%nd`(n为数字)来设定浮点数的最小宽度为n个字符。此外,可以使用 `-` 标记来让浮点数左对齐。

结论

通过上述方式,我们可以灵活地输出浮点数,满足不同的需求。无论是保留特定的小数位数,还是以科学计数法的形式输出,C语言都提供了丰富的输出选项。熟练掌握这些输出方式,将有助于更好地展示和处理浮点数数据。

通过小编的介绍,相信大家对以上问题有了更深入的了解,也有了自己的答案吧,生活经验网将不断更新,喜欢我们记得收藏起来,顺便分享下。

99%的人还看了

猜你感兴趣

版权申明

本文"浮点数在C语言中的输出方式":http://eshow365.cn/3-18743-0.html 内容来自互联网,请自行判断内容的正确性。如有侵权请联系我们,立即删除!